Geometry-based triangulation of trimmed NURBS surfaces

被引:60
作者
Piegl, LA
Tiller, W
机构
[1] Univ S Florida, Dept Comp Sci & Engn, Tampa, FL 33620 USA
[2] Geomware Inc, Tyler, TX 75703 USA
基金
美国国家科学基金会;
关键词
trimmed surfaces; NURBS; triangulation;
D O I
10.1016/S0010-4485(97)00047-X
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
An algorithm for obtaining a piecewise triangular approximation of a trimmed NURBS surface is presented. The algorithm is geometry based, i.e. the surface is subdivided into triangular facets based on its geometric characteristics and not on its parametrization. No assumption is made about the surface's parametrical representation; it does not have to be continuously differentiable, only C-0 continuity is assumed. The surface subdivision is performed in model space, however, the triangulation is carried out in parameter space using the parametric vertices of subdivision rectangles, Along with computing the triangulation, the method produces a compact database for browsing in the triangular irregular network, e.g. finding all neighbors of a given triangle. (C) 1998 Elsevier Science Ltd. All rights reserved.
引用
收藏
页码:11 / 18
页数:8
相关论文
共 29 条
[1]  
ABIEZZI S, 1991, P EUROGRAPHICS 91, P385
[2]  
ABIEZZI SS, 1994, COMPUT GRAPH FORUM, V13, pC107, DOI 10.1111/1467-8659.1330107
[3]   TRIMMED-PATCH BOUNDARY ELEMENTS - BRIDGING THE GAP BETWEEN SOLID MODELING AND ENGINEERING ANALYSIS [J].
CASALE, MS ;
BOBROW, JE ;
UNDERWOOD, R .
COMPUTER-AIDED DESIGN, 1992, 24 (04) :193-199
[4]   FREE-FORM SOLID MODELING WITH TRIMMED SURFACE PATCHES [J].
CASALE, MS .
IEEE COMPUTER GRAPHICS AND APPLICATIONS, 1987, 7 (01) :33-43
[5]   FUNCTIONAL COMPOSITION ALGORITHMS VIA BLOSSOMING [J].
DEROSE, TD ;
GOLDMAN, RN ;
HAGEN, H ;
MANN, S .
ACM TRANSACTIONS ON GRAPHICS, 1993, 12 (02) :113-135
[6]   COMPOSING BEZIER SIMPLEXES [J].
DEROSE, TD .
ACM TRANSACTIONS ON GRAPHICS, 1988, 7 (03) :198-221
[7]  
DOLENC A, 1991, MATH SURFACES, V4, P1
[8]   Error bounded piecewise linear approximation of freeform surfaces [J].
Elber, G .
COMPUTER-AIDED DESIGN, 1996, 28 (01) :51-57
[9]  
FANG TP, 1993, IEEE COMPUTER GRAPHI, V12